一台服务器如何集群

worktile 其他 22

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    服务器集群是将多台服务器连接起来,形成一个高可用、高性能和可伸缩的系统。它可以提供更好的响应时间、更高的负载承受能力和更好的系统可靠性。那么,如何实现服务器集群呢?下面我将详细介绍。

    一、服务器选择:
    为了实现服务器集群,你需要选择合适的服务器并确保它们能够支持集群工作负载。常见的服务器选择包括物理服务器和虚拟服务器,根据你的需求和预算选择合适的选项。

    二、网络连接:
    服务器集群的关键是服务器之间的网络连接。你需要确保服务器之间的网络连接可靠且高速,以便进行数据共享和负载均衡。常见的网络连接方式包括局域网和广域网。

    三、负载均衡:
    负载均衡是服务器集群的核心概念之一。它可以确保请求被均匀地分发到集群中的各个服务器上,从而提高系统的性能和可用性。常见的负载均衡算法包括轮询、加权轮询、最少连接和最少响应时间。

    四、数据同步:
    在服务器集群中,数据同步是不可或缺的。你需要确保集群中的数据保持一致性,避免数据冲突和丢失。常见的数据同步方法包括主从复制和多主复制。

    五、高可用性:
    服务器集群的目标之一是提高系统的可用性。你可以使用热备份或冷备份来实现服务器的容错性。当主服务器出现故障时,备份服务器会接管主服务器的工作,从而确保系统的连续性。

    六、监控和管理:
    服务器集群需要进行监控和管理,以确保系统的正常运行。你可以使用监控工具和管理软件来监控服务器的性能、负载和资源使用情况,并及时采取措施进行故障排除和性能优化。

    七、故障恢复:
    当服务器集群中的某个服务器出现故障时,你需要能够快速恢复系统,并确保业务的连续性。你可以使用备份服务器、容错机制和自动故障转移来实现快速的故障恢复。

    总结起来,服务器集群可以提供更好的性能、可用性和扩展性。通过选择合适的服务器、建立可靠的网络连接、实现负载均衡、进行数据同步、确保高可用性、监控和管理服务器以及实施故障恢复机制,可以成功地实现服务器集群。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    服务器集群是一种用于提高可用性和性能的服务器架构,它将多台服务器连接起来共同处理请求,具有更高的容错性和可伸缩性。下面是一台服务器如何进行集群的步骤:

    1. 配置硬件:首先,确保服务器的硬件配置满足集群需求。服务器应具备足够的处理能力,内存和存储容量,以及可靠的网络连接。

    2. 安装操作系统:为每台服务器安装操作系统。常用的服务器操作系统包括Linux和Windows Server。操作系统应选择可以支持集群功能的版本。

    3. 设置网络:服务器之间的通信关键之一是设置正确的网络配置。每台服务器应该在相同的网络子网中,有唯一的IP地址,并且可以相互通信。

    4. 搭建集群软件:选择一个适合的集群软件,常见的有Hadoop、Kubernetes、Docker Swarm等。安装和配置集群软件,确保各个服务器可以加入集群并进行通信。

    5. 配置负载均衡:负载均衡是集群的核心概念之一,它可以将请求平均分配到集群中的各个服务器上,以实现更高的性能和可用性。常见的负载均衡策略有轮询、最少连接和基于性能等。

    6. 数据同步和备份:在服务器集群中,数据的一致性非常关键。根据需求选择合适的数据同步机制,例如使用分布式文件系统或数据库进行数据同步和备份,以保证数据的完整性和可靠性。

    7. 监控和管理:为了保证服务器集群的稳定运行,需要实时监控和管理集群的各个节点。选择适合的监控工具,例如Zabbix、Nagios等,对服务器资源、性能和错误进行监控和告警。

    总结起来,服务器集群的搭建涉及硬件配置、操作系统安装、网络设置、集群软件搭建、负载均衡配置、数据同步和备份以及监控和管理等多个方面。正确的集群配置和管理可以提高服务器的可用性、性能和可扩展性。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    一台服务器的集群是通过将多台服务器构建成一个集群来实现的。集群可以提供更高的可用性、可扩展性和性能,以满足大规模应用的需求。下面是一台服务器如何集群的操作流程:

    1. 确定集群的需求和目标
      在进行服务器集群之前,首先需要确定集群的需求和目标。例如,需要提高系统的可用性、扩展性、性能等方面的目标。

    2. 选择适合的集群技术和工具
      根据集群的需求和目标,选择适合的集群技术和工具。常见的集群技术包括负载均衡、故障转移、分布式存储等。

    3. 部署和配置集群软件
      安装并配置集群软件,如负载均衡器、故障转移工具、分布式存储系统等。根据具体的集群技术,进行相应的配置和调优。

    4. 配置网络和安全设置
      配置服务器之间的网络设置,包括IP地址、子网掩码、网关等。确保服务器之间可以相互通信,并配置相应的安全设置,如防火墙、访问控制列表等。

    5. 设置负载均衡
      利用负载均衡器,将请求分发到集群中的多个服务器。负载均衡可以根据预设的算法,如轮询、加权轮询、最少连接等,在多个服务器之间均衡地分配请求负载。

    6. 配置故障转移
      配置故障转移工具,以确保高可用性。当一个服务器出现故障时,故障转移工具可以自动将请求转移到其他正常工作的服务器上,避免服务中断。

    7. 部署分布式存储系统
      如果需要共享数据或文件,可以部署分布式存储系统。分布式存储系统可以将数据分布到集群中的多个节点上,实现数据的冗余备份和高可用性。

    8. 进行性能调优
      对集群进行性能调优,以提升系统的性能和吞吐量。可以进行服务器的硬件升级、优化应用程序的代码,或者调整集群软件的配置参数等。

    9. 监控和管理集群
      设置集群的监控和管理系统,实时监控服务器的状态、性能指标等。同时,可以利用自动化工具简化集群的管理和维护。

    10. 定期更新和维护
      集群需要定期进行更新和维护,包括安装操作系统的补丁、更新集群软件的版本等。定期的维护可以确保集群的安全性和稳定性。

    通过以上操作流程,一台服务器就可以成功建立成集群,并实现更高的可用性、可扩展性和性能。集群技术的应用可以满足大规模应用的需求,提供更好的用户体验和服务质量。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部